When Hughes asks how long can the Civil Aeronautics Board keep the Constellations grounded, Frye replies until the CAB completes its investigation into "the Redding (Pennsylvania) crash". Although all Constellations were grounded from 12 July - 23 August 1946 (when the scene must take place), there wasn't a commercial plane crash in the US in 1945 or 1946, and there wasn't a crash involving a Constellation until 20 October 1948.
